Trademark Registration in India: Process, Cost & Why It Matters

June 3, 2026 · 2 min read

Your brand name and logo are among your most valuable assets — but only if you own them legally. Trademark registration gives you exclusive rights to your mark and the power to stop copycats.

What Can Be Trademarked?

  • Brand and product names
  • Logos and symbols
  • Taglines and slogans
  • Distinctive shapes, sounds or colours (in some cases)

Trademark Classes

Trademarks are registered under one or more of 45 classes (1–34 for goods, 35–45 for services). You must choose the class(es) that match your business — for example, software falls under Class 9/42, while consulting services fall under Class 35.

Step-by-Step Registration Process

  1. Trademark search — check the IP India database to ensure your mark is available.
  2. File the application (Form TM-A) under the correct class(es).
  3. Once filed, you can use the ™ symbol immediately.
  4. The Registry examines the application and may raise objections.
  5. The mark is published in the Trademark Journal for opposition (4 months).
  6. If unopposed, the mark is registered and you receive the certificate — now you can use the ® symbol.

Cost & Timeline

Government fees are lower for individuals, startups (DPIIT recognised) and MSMEs than for large companies. Registration, if smooth, takes around 12–18 months, but your priority and ™ rights start from the filing date. A registered trademark is valid for 10 years and renewable indefinitely.

™ vs ®

  • — claimed but not yet registered (can be used immediately after filing).
  • ® — registered and legally protected (only after the certificate is issued).

Frequently Asked Questions

Do startups get a fee discount? Yes — DPIIT-recognised startups and MSMEs pay reduced government fees.

Can I file before launching? Yes, you can file on a “proposed to be used” basis to secure your name early.
